I found these in the engineering section at Barnes and Nobel. They cover all process from OA, ARC, TIG, MIG  all the way to Spray ARC. They would be great for someone just starting out and a great reference book for the aging Weldor with a mature memory. Welding Essentialsquestions and answersexpanded first editionby William Galvery and Frank MarlowIndustrial Press Inc. www.industrialpress.comWelding Skillssecond editionby R.T. Reply:I have Welding Essentials, and use it frequently for reference. There's a companion book "Welding Fabrication and Repair" that is also excellent.
